Makil U. Pundaodaya Vs. Commission on Elections, et al.

MAKIL U. PUNDAODAYA, Petitioner, versus COMMISSION ON ELECTIONS and ARSENIO DENSING NOBLE, Respondents.

G.R. No. 179313 | 2009-09-17

DECISION


YNARES-SANTIAGO, J.:

This petition[1] for certiorari under Rule 65 assails the August 3, 2007 Resolution[2] of the Commission on Elections (COMELEC) En Banc in SPA No. 07-202, which declared private respondent Arsenio Densing Noble (Noble) qualified to run for municipal mayor of Kinoguitan, Misamis Oriental, in the May 14, 2007 Synchronized National and Local Elections.

The facts are as follows:

Petitioner Makil U. Pundaodaya (Pundaodaya) is married to Judith Pundaodaya, who ran against Noble for the position of municipal mayor of Kinoguitan, Misamis Oriental in the 2007 elections.
